Brassavola flagellaris
3 Attachment(s)
Got this in 2013, up to 3' long bean like leaves, easy grower, great night scent, 6 flowers on one spike 13 on other.

Quote:
The scent is interesting within Brassavola. They each seem to have the same base scent but nodosa is more spicy. Of the ones I have, my favorite is cordata v. alba (subulifolia) and perrinii. They are just sweet and it smells wonderful. Three foot long leaves of frag. must be a show stopper. Thanks for posting. I always like to see new stuff. |
